About the function
The post holder will support the development and delivery of an externally funded research project exploring the practices and system requirements to support women with learning disabilities going through the menopause. Working with participants with lived practice, healthcare professionals and commissioners, the project will include developing study protocol, gaining NHS and University ethical approvals, data collection and analysis and leading on the writing up pf the executive report and supporting publications to be submitted to peer-reviewed journals.
This post is a fixed-term contract until 31/03/2025.
What you can bring
The prosperous candidate will possess a postgraduate qualification significant to this project have practice in carrying out UK located research with people with learning disabilities or other vulnerable populations significant to this project, and their carers. They will also have a track record of carrying out applied health research project to time and target, be practiced in NHS and other ethical approval processes and have qualitative methodological practice, evidenced by high quality publications.
